Background technique
Currently, in construction, it is often necessary to use various forms of profiles, such as steel plate, steel pipe and fashioned iron.It is existing
Carry that these profiles use be mostly suspension hook add the combination of wirerope or using the interim suspension centre of welding in the form of hung
Dress, such lifting mode is not only troublesome in poeration, switch between differential profiles it is not convenient, and be easy profile is caused to grind
Damage, in this way after handling, it is also necessary to repair be carried out to profile, manpower and material resources are not only wasted, moreover, also increasing
Production cost causes unnecessary loss.
